Cruclix™ Hollow Fiber Filters from BioLink are designed for tangential flow membrane separations, including two categories: microfiltration and ultrafiltration. Cruclix™Hollow Fiber filters offer a range of sizes from small to large, support applications from drugdevelopment,pilot scale to commercial manufacturing.Cruclix™ Hollow Fiber Filters offer both standard models for regular environments and modelsautoclavable, to meet the requirements of different usage scenarios.
Lysate clarification
Cell concentration, clarification, diafiltration
Virus purification, concentration, diafiltration
Recombinant protein purification,concentration, diafiltration
Inclusion body clarification and renaturation
Nanoparticle diafiltration and aeparation
Liposome concentration and diafiltration

Regulatory Compliance
Cruclix™ Hollow Fiber filters, have been reviewed and approved by authoritative institutions andcomply with the 1s0 13485 quality system. They are developed, designed, and manufactured underthis quality management system, All products are manufactured in a Class 7 cleanroom accordingto lS0 standards and are subject to strict quality inspection. Only those that pass the inspection arereleased with a quality certificate. All raw materials and manufacturing processes used in the production can be traced by the serialnumber iS/N code), The hollow fibers used in the column are made from animal-free materials, andall fluid path materials have been tested and meet the USP <88> Class Vl biocompatibility standards
